As part of onboarding, you should know we're replacing Stackmule, our homegrown job queue, with the new Driftline scheduler. Stackmule served us well but lacks retry semantics and observability, and only two people still understand its locking code. Migration happens service by service; the Billing and Notifications teams have already cut over. New jobs should target Driftline directly rather than adding Stackmule dependencies. The migration plan, timelines, and per-service checklist are maintained on the internal tracking page.

operations page: https://jenkins.zemvarcloud.local/job/merge_requests/repo/build/73930b4b30f0a8ed

## Event Schemas

Hey, welcome aboard! Every event your plugin emits into Larkfield has to match a registered schema in the Ossify registry — no freeform payloads, sorry. Versioning is additive-only, so breaking changes mean a new schema ID. The registration workflow, naming rules, and review checklist are documented on our internal portal.

operations page: https://confluence.tolvaqsys.corp/spaces/pages/pages/6e787158f507

HANDOVER NOTE — For the Board

From the outgoing Director of Legal Affairs to her successor, regarding the Solvane licensing dispute. Calyx Systems alleges our Windrow module exceeds the agreed field-of-use terms; we maintain the 2019 amendment covers it. Mediation is scheduled for early spring, and outside counsel at Harrow & Slate has prepared a settlement range. All correspondence is archived and indexed. Please review the chronology carefully before the next board session. The wider commercial considerations are recorded in the note below.

board note of fahag-tajop: The eastern region missed its Julix quota by 44.0 percent last quarter. Ralionax Holdings plans to lower the Druath list price by 61.8 percent in March. The board signed off on a budget of $295.0 million for Project Gilath. The renewal with Ruswynix Systems closes at $274.5 million a year, 17.0 percent above the last contract.

Runbook: Scanline barcode bridge

If warehouse scans stop flowing into Cartwheel, it's almost always the bridge service on the Dunmore floor box wedging after a USB hiccup. Bounce the service first — nine times out of ten that fixes it. If not, check the queue depth before escalating. When restarting, make sure the bridge comes up with these settings.

deployment values, yafop-bajef:
[gilok]
team = ulaius
access_code = ac_423664
host = gilok.sivrelhq.corp
port = 9200
owner = pelius.istax
peer = eliok.torvasoft.internal